(4) _The equation form._--The equation form with an unknown quantity to
be determined, or a missing number to be found, should be connected with
its meaning and with the problem attitude long before a pupil begins
algebra, and in the minds of pupils who never will study algebra.
Children who have just barely learned to add and subtract learn easily
to do such work as the following:--
Write the missing numbers:--
4 + 8 = ....
5 + .... = 14
.... + 3 = 11
.... = 5 + 2
16 = 7 + ....
12 = .... + 5
The equation form is the simplest uniform way yet devised to state a
quantitative issue. It is capable of indefinite extension if certain
easily understood conventions about parentheses and fraction signs are
learned. It should be employed widely in accounting and the treatment of
commercial problems, and would be except for outworn conventions. It is
a leading contribution of algebra to business and industrial life.
Arithmetic can make it nearly as well. It saves more time in the case of
drills on reducing fractions to higher and lower terms alone than is
required to learn its meaning and use. To rewrite a quantitative
problem as an equation and then make the easy selection of the
necessary technique to solve the equation is one of the most universally
useful intellectual devices known to man. The words 'equals,' 'equal,'
'is,' 'are,' 'makes,' 'make,' 'gives,' 'give,' and their rarer
equivalents should therefore early give way on many occasions to the '='
which so far surpasses them in ultimate convenience and simplicity.
